Microgrid Design Toolkit (MDT) User Guide Software (V.1.1)

The Microgrid Design Toolkit (MDT) most readily supports decision analysis for new ("greenfield") microgrid designs, but can also be used to evaluate microgrids with existing infrastructure under some limitations. The current version of MDT includes two main capabilities. The first capability, the Microgrid Sizing Capability (MSC), is used to determine the size and composition of a new microgrid in the early stages of the design process. MSC is focused on developing a microgrid that is economically viable when connected to the grid. The second capability is focused on refining a microgrid design for operation in islanded mode. This second capability relies on two models: the Technology Management Optimization (TMO) model and Performance Reliability Model (PRM).
